Call Waiting mode

Enabling the Call Waiting mode will let the IP Phone send a notification tone to you
when you are in a phone call and receiving a second incoming call.

Disabling this mode will let the IP Phone reject any incoming call with a busy message
when the IP Phone is occupied in a call.


3.3.3 Hotline Setting

The IP3092 Communication provides 3 hotline numbers, when the user press IP3092’s
Hotline” hard key, the Communicator will auto dial out the first hotline number. If no
body answers the call until timeout (you can configure the timeout setting from IP3092’s
web interface, please refer to the IP3092 User Manual for the configuration of IP3092
web interface), the Communicator will terminate the first call, and dial the second hotline
number out. The round robin will be continued among these 3 hotline numbers until a
call is answered, or the hotline call is cancelled.

You can configure the 3 hotline number from both Communicator Web Interface or from
IP Commander.

To configure the hotline numbers from IP Commander:
1. Select “Settings” command from the main menu.
2. Select “Phone Settings” from the sub-command area
3. Select “Hotline” from the sub-command area
4. A Hotline Settings window is displayed, allow you to input the Hotline numbers.

You can also fill out the “Hotline Address”, this hotline address will be sent to the
hotline party from IP3092 built-in Instant Message

5. Press “Save” to confirm the hotline settings.
